The treadmill is one of the most sought-after home exercise equipments. It provides an easy and effective aerobic exercise. The best treadmills for home use have various features that make running easier and more enjoyable. Some treadmills come with incline options, which enable the user to run or walk uphill, and increase the intensity of their workout. They also come with built-in displays that display their speed and distance as well as their heart rate, which makes it easy to monitor their progress and remain motivated.

A treadmill at home can help people overcome barriers to exercise like busy schedules or bad weather. The treadmill is a great option for people who are just beginning to get started in running. It can help them gain stamina and still be secure. This treadmill is a great investment for anyone who wants to lose weight and improve their fitness. It can be able to burn up to 600 calories per hour when running at maximum speed.

Treadmills are an incredibly versatile piece of equipment for exercise that can be used for walking or jogging as well as for high-intensity interval training. Most of them can also be folded up and stored away when not being used, making them a great option for space-constrained homes. Many of the most well-known models have features such as incline options and heart rate sensors. They also include digital display screens to assist you in tracking your progress.

A quality home treadmill should come with a safety clip that will stop the belt in case you fall off during your run, as this will aid in avoiding injury. It should also have handrails on the sides to aid in keeping your balance and keep you supported throughout your workout. A built-in fan will keep you cool on a hot day. It's also a good idea to look for a warranty that covers the frame and motor in case of any problems.

Some of the best treadmills at home come with an automatic incline feature that automatically alters the deck's angle when you increase or reduce the incline. This is especially useful for preventing injury, as you don't have to strain your joints and back. It will still provide an excellent cardio workout. Some treadmills provide "fat-burning" workouts that alternate between short bursts of intense walking and running. This is a good method to burn calories while boosting your endurance.

Commercial Treadmills

Commercial treadmills are designed to endure the wear and tear of fitness centers and gyms that are crowded with people centers. They are also specifically designed for physical therapy clinics as well as other similar fitness centers. They are typically more durable and have a greater capacity for weight, and have advanced features, such as customizable workout programs and interactive touchscreens to improve the motivation of users and monitor their progress.

Commercial treadmills are usually more powerful than traditional models. The higher CHP of commercial treadmills allow them to support greater frequency of use and intense training. They also come with a fan to reduce the risk that they will overheat and cause technical issues. They require less maintenance as well.

Many of these machines have adjustable incline settings to simulate the sensation of walking uphill or running. This helps to improve posture and strengthen muscles, as well as burn more calories. Many of them even offer an option to decrease which is beneficial for those looking to improve their running technique.

Commercial treadmills are also more accessible to people of different fitness levels and body types due to the fact that they have a greater weight capacity. These machines can accommodate users up to 400 pounds, making them more inclusive and comfortable for a wider range of people.

The cost of these machines is usually prohibitive, despite the benefits. Be aware of the following factors when deciding whether to purchase one of these treadmills:

How many people will be expected to be using the treadmill? How often? What is the space you have for the machine? Will you need extras like built-in tracking systems or integrated fitness apps? If you know these answers, you can decide whether buying commercial treadmills sale uk is the right option for your office or home.

Desk Treadmills

Treadmill desks or walk-and work desks bring together the best of two worlds: walking while you work. These desks are an excellent way to stay active and burn calories throughout the day. They can also lower the risk of obesity, heart disease, and forward head posture, which can be caused by sitting for long periods.

They are not for everyone. These treadmill-desk combinations take up the majority of floor space, and might not be suitable for people who have a small workspace or live in cramped spaces. They are also designed for low-intensity walks, and therefore they may not offer the same level of in cardiovascular exercise as a treadmill provides.

Fortunately, there are now more treadmills under desks than ever before. Citysports' treadmill under the desk comes at a reasonable price and has a stylish aesthetic. The treadmill is easy to use and has an easy interface. It can run at speeds that can reach 2.5 miles per hour when the handrails are lower. It has LED lights that track the duration of your walk and a remote to adjust the speed, and a space to put your smartphone.

Another great option is the LifeSpan TR1200-DT3-BT underneath desk treadmill. It's designed to make exercising easy and is available in seven different colors. The under-desk model is slimmer than other models and takes up less space. It also comes with an all-year motor guarantee. This treadmill can be used to keep track of up your steps while you work and also comes with six automatic programs that you can pick depending on your goals.

Used Treadmills

Treadmills provide a full cardiovascular exercise for walkers, runners or those who wish to increase their fitness. The modern features of new treadmills might appeal to some, but for those who do not require them, a secondhand treadmill can offer a fantastic exercise without having to pay for gym memberships or travel costs.

When choosing a used treadmill it's important to assess its condition, particularly the motor. It must be in good shape and free of damage. If it's not, it will likely require costly repairs in the future. It's also worth assessing the belt for any obvious warps, tears or other signs of wear and tear.

Another thing to consider is how much the treadmill has been used. If it's been used extensively, then you'll probably have to replace it earlier than a treadmill that's been barely used. You can ask the seller for this, or if purchasing from a reputable retailer, they should be able to provide service records for the treadmill.

The incline and decline abilities of the treadmill must be taken into consideration as well. This is especially true for runners who are serious. Treadmills with higher incline settings let you concentrate on certain muscle groups and build endurance without the need to go outside. This is especially important for people who live in areas with hills.

It is also important to be aware of the cushioning provided by treadmills. This isn't always a big selling point but it's an important aspect that can drastically reduce the impact of your workout on joints. Brands like Precor and Life Fitness build their treadmills with a cushioning system in the front, where your feet will be. They also provide stability when you step off.

If you are considering purchasing a used treadmill, it is important to take into consideration the availability of spare parts. While most modern treadmills come with a variety of different replacement parts however, it's more difficult to find replacements for older models.
